WebTo convert "bigger" units to "smaller" ones, you multiply. To convert "smaller" to bigger, you divide. Pound is something big, and ounce is something small - smaller parts make one big thing - 16 ounces are in a pound. To convert pounds to ounces, you multiply by 16. The United States system of units of 1832 is based on the system in use in Britain prior to the introduction to the British imperial system on January 1, 1826. Both systems are derived from English units, a system which had evolved over the millennia before American independence, and which had its roots in both Roman and Anglo-Saxon units.
